About

Sven Bölte is a scholar working on Cognitive Neuroscience, Clinical Psychology and Psychiatry and Mental health. According to data from OpenAlex, Sven Bölte has authored 393 papers receiving a total of 11.6k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 296 papers in Cognitive Neuroscience, 158 papers in Clinical Psychology and 139 papers in Psychiatry and Mental health. Recurrent topics in Sven Bölte’s work include Autism Spectrum Disorder Research (273 papers), Family and Disability Support Research (93 papers) and Genetics and Neurodevelopmental Disorders (77 papers). Sven Bölte is often cited by papers focused on Autism Spectrum Disorder Research (273 papers), Family and Disability Support Research (93 papers) and Genetics and Neurodevelopmental Disorders (77 papers). Sven Bölte collaborates with scholars based in Sweden, Australia and Germany. Sven Bölte's co-authors include Fritz Poustka, Martin Holtmann, Terje Falck‐Ytter, Sonya Girdler, Peter B. Marschik, Paul Lichtenstein, Tatja Hirvikoski, Henrik Larsson, Gustaf Gredebäck and John N. Constantino and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ature Communications, Journal of Clinical Oncology and Journal of Neuroscience.
